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. In a large mixing bowl combine sugar, brown sugar, oats, and cornflakes.
  3. Stir in cooled melted butter, eggs, and vanilla and mix well.
  4. Add optional ingredients as you like - I added them all and they were delicious.
  5. In a medium mixing bowl combine fl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
  6. Add flour mixture to above mixture stirring to mix well.
  7. Drop by tablespoonfuls onto a greased baking dish and bake at 350 degrees for 12 to 15 minutes or until lightly golden brown.
